在当今数据驱动的时代,企业越来越依赖于数据分析和预测来优化决策。指标预测分析作为一种重要的数据分析方法,能够帮助企业提前预知关键业务指标的变化趋势,从而制定更有效的策略。而基于机器学习的指标预测分析方法,更是通过强大的算法模型,显著提升了预测的准确性和效率。本文将深入探讨基于机器学习的指标预测分析方法及优化策略,并结合实际应用场景,为企业提供实用的指导。
一、指标预测分析的定义与重要性
1. 定义
指标预测分析是指通过对历史数据的分析,利用统计学或机器学习算法,预测未来某一特定指标的变化趋势。这些指标可以是销售额、用户增长率、设备故障率等,广泛应用于金融、零售、制造、医疗等多个行业。
2. 重要性
- 优化决策:通过预测未来趋势,企业可以提前制定应对策略,避免因突发事件导致的损失。
- 提升效率:机器学习模型能够快速处理大量数据,显著提高预测效率。
- 数据驱动的洞察:指标预测分析不仅提供预测结果,还能揭示数据背后的规律和模式,为企业提供更深层次的洞察。
二、基于机器学习的指标预测分析方法
1. 数据准备
数据准备是指标预测分析的基础,主要包括以下几个步骤:
- 数据收集:从企业内部系统(如数据库、日志文件)或外部数据源(如公开数据集)获取相关数据。
- 数据清洗:处理缺失值、异常值和重复数据,确保数据质量。
- 数据特征工程:提取与目标指标相关的特征,并对特征进行标准化或归一化处理。
示例:假设我们希望预测某产品的销售量,可能需要收集过去几年的销售数据、市场推广费用、季节性因素等信息。
2. 特征工程
特征工程是机器学习模型性能提升的关键步骤。通过合理的特征选择和处理,可以显著提高模型的预测能力。
- 特征选择:从大量数据中筛选出对目标指标影响最大的特征。
- 特征变换:对特征进行线性变换(如标准化)或非线性变换(如多项式变换),以提高模型的拟合能力。
- 特征组合:将多个特征组合成新的特征,例如将“天气”和“季节”组合成“天气季节”特征。
3. 模型选择与训练
根据业务需求和数据特性,选择合适的机器学习模型进行训练。
- 回归模型:用于预测连续型指标,如线性回归、随机森林回归、XGBoost回归等。
- 时间序列模型:用于预测具有时间依赖性的指标,如ARIMA、LSTM、Prophet等。
- 集成模型:通过集成多个模型(如投票法、堆叠法)进一步提升预测性能。
4. 模型评估与调优
模型评估是确保预测结果准确性的关键步骤。
- 评估指标:常用的评估指标包括均方误差(MSE)、平均绝对误差(MAE)、R平方值(R²)等。
- 交叉验证:通过交叉验证(如K折交叉验证)评估模型的泛化能力。
- 超参数调优:通过网格搜索或随机搜索优化模型的超参数,进一步提升性能。
三、指标预测分析的优化策略
1. 数据质量的优化
数据质量直接影响模型的预测效果。为了提高数据质量,可以采取以下措施:
- 数据清洗:通过自动化工具(如Python的Pandas库)快速处理缺失值和异常值。
- 数据增强:通过数据生成技术(如合成数据)补充数据量不足的情况。
- 数据标注:对数据进行人工标注,确保数据的准确性和一致性。
2. 模型优化
模型优化是提升预测准确性的核心步骤。
- 模型集成:通过集成多个模型(如投票法、堆叠法)进一步提升预测性能。
- 模型调优:通过网格搜索或随机搜索优化模型的超参数。
- 模型解释性:通过特征重要性分析(如SHAP值)理解模型的决策逻辑。
3. 预测结果的可视化与解释
预测结果的可视化和解释是将数据分析成果转化为业务价值的关键。
- 可视化工具:使用数据可视化工具(如Tableau、Power BI)将预测结果以图表形式展示。
- 数字孪生技术:通过数字孪生技术将预测结果与实际业务场景结合,提供更直观的洞察。
- 数字可视化:通过动态图表和仪表盘实时展示预测结果,帮助企业快速响应变化。
四、基于机器学习的指标预测分析的实际应用
1. 数据中台的应用
数据中台是企业级的数据管理平台,能够为企业提供统一的数据存储、处理和分析能力。基于机器学习的指标预测分析可以无缝集成到数据中台中,为企业提供高效的数据分析服务。
- 数据整合:数据中台可以将分散在各个系统中的数据整合到一起,为指标预测分析提供统一的数据源。
- 数据处理:数据中台可以自动化处理数据,包括数据清洗、特征工程等,显著提高数据处理效率。
- 模型部署:数据中台可以支持机器学习模型的部署和管理,确保模型能够实时处理数据并输出预测结果。
2. 数字孪生的应用
数字孪生是一种通过数字模型模拟物理世界的技术,广泛应用于制造业、智慧城市等领域。基于机器学习的指标预测分析可以与数字孪生技术结合,提供更精准的预测和决策支持。
- 实时预测:通过数字孪生技术,可以实时监控物理系统的运行状态,并利用机器学习模型预测未来的变化趋势。
- 动态优化:基于预测结果,数字孪生系统可以动态调整系统参数,优化系统性能。
- 可视化展示:数字孪生系统可以通过三维可视化技术,将预测结果以更直观的方式展示给用户。
3. 数字可视化的应用
数字可视化是将数据以图表、仪表盘等形式展示的技术,能够帮助企业快速理解和分析数据。基于机器学习的指标预测分析可以与数字可视化技术结合,提供更丰富的数据洞察。
- 动态图表:通过数字可视化技术,可以将预测结果以动态图表的形式展示,帮助企业实时监控指标变化。
- 交互式分析:用户可以通过交互式图表与模型进行互动,探索不同假设下的预测结果。
- 数据故事讲述:通过数字可视化技术,可以将预测结果转化为数据故事,帮助业务人员更好地理解数据分析成果。
五、案例分析:基于机器学习的指标预测分析在某企业的应用
1. 业务背景
某制造企业希望预测其产品的月度销售量,以便更好地规划生产计划和库存管理。
2. 数据准备
- 数据收集:收集过去3年的销售数据、市场推广费用、季节性因素等信息。
- 数据清洗:处理缺失值和异常值,确保数据质量。
- 特征工程:提取与销售量相关的特征,包括价格、广告投入、季节等因素。
3. 模型选择与训练
- 模型选择:选择随机森林回归模型进行训练。
- 模型训练:利用历史数据训练模型,并通过交叉验证评估模型性能。
4. 模型评估与调优
- 评估指标:通过均方误差(MSE)和R平方值(R²)评估模型性能。
- 超参数调优:通过网格搜索优化模型的超参数,进一步提升预测性能。
5. 预测结果与应用
- 预测结果:模型预测未来3个月的销售量,并提供置信区间。
- 应用价值:企业可以根据预测结果调整生产计划和库存管理,显著降低库存成本和生产浪费。
六、结论与展望
基于机器学习的指标预测分析方法为企业提供了强大的数据分析工具,能够帮助企业提前预知关键业务指标的变化趋势,从而制定更有效的决策。随着数据中台、数字孪生和数字可视化技术的不断发展,指标预测分析的应用场景将更加广泛,预测的准确性和效率也将进一步提升。
未来,随着人工智能和大数据技术的不断进步,指标预测分析将为企业提供更深层次的洞察和更高效的决策支持。企业可以通过申请试用相关工具(申请试用)和技术,进一步提升自身的数据分析能力。
通过本文的介绍,相信读者对基于机器学习的指标预测分析方法及优化策略有了更深入的了解。如果您对相关技术感兴趣,可以进一步了解并尝试应用到实际业务中。
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。